Preparation and Cooking Time


The entire process of making Cinnamon Tea is straightforward and efficient. Here’s a breakdown of time:
Preparation Time: 5 minutes
Brewing Time: 10-15 minutes
Total Time: 15-20 minutes
This quick timeframe makes Cinnamon Tea a convenient option for any time of day, whether you need an energizing morning boost or a soothing evening ritual.

Ingredients


– 2 cups water
– 1-2 cinnamon sticks (or 1 teaspoon of ground cinnamon)
– 1-2 teaspoons honey (optional)
– A squeeze of lemon juice (optional)
– A pinch of black pepper (optional for extra kick)

Step-by-Step Instructions


Making Cinnamon Tea is a simple and gratifying endeavor. Follow these steps for a perfect cup:
1. Boil Water: In a small pot, bring the water to a boil over medium-high heat.
2. Add Cinnamon: Once the water is boiling, add the cinnamon sticks or ground cinnamon to the pot.
3. Simmer: Reduce the heat to low and let the mixture simmer for about 10-15 minutes. This allows the flavors to meld and the beneficial compounds to extract.
4. Remove from Heat: After simmering, take the pot off the heat and let it cool briefly.
5. Strain: If you used cinnamon sticks, remove them from the pot. If you used ground cinnamon, you might want to strain the tea to eliminate the sediment.
6. Sweeten (Optional): If desired, stir in honey for sweetness and add a squeeze of lemon juice for additional flavor.
7. Serve: Pour the tea into cups, and enjoy it while it’s warm.

Freezing and Storage


Storage: Store any leftover Cinnamon Tea in a sealed container in the fridge for up to 3 days. Reheat gently when ready to serve.
Freezing: While it’s best enjoyed fresh, you can freeze brewed tea in ice cube trays. Use these cubes to chill future batches without dilution.

Frequently Asked Questions


Can I use store-bought cinnamon tea bags instead?
Yes, although loose cinnamon provides a richer flavor, tea bags can be a quick and easy alternative.
Is Cinnamon Tea safe during pregnancy?
While moderate consumption is generally considered safe, always consult with a healthcare provider for personalized advice.
Can I enjoy Cinnamon Tea cold?
Absolutely! Brew the tea, cool it, and serve it over ice for a refreshing summer drink.
